Ogr2ogr csv driver failed to create

As mentioned, ogr2ogr can be used to create a data dump in some supported writable format. While gdal itself deals with raster data geotiffs, ecw, dems and the like its sister project, ogr, deals with vector data formats such as esri shapefiles, mapinfo, kml, or sql server geographygeometry data the ogr2ogr utility is the. I tried to create the table first and using the command to insert on it. Using ogr2ogr to convert, reproject, and load spatial data to. Aug 25, 2017 i am running the following ogr2ogr command line to import a shp file into my sql server db. Cluster shared volume csv inside out clustering and. Using ogr2ogr to convert, reproject, and load spatial data. Update 3this script below does not reproduce the issue,only ogr2ogr. As well as the validation problems reported by alex mandel, the structure of this kml file isnt appropriate for straight conversion to a shape or csv file. A readonly jdbc driver for java that uses comma separated value csv files as database tables. Converting csv files to esri shapefile format geocode my. I want to export a table inside my database as an mapinfo file. Dbeaver has a lot of preconfigured driver including sql, nosql, keyvalue databases, graph databases, search engines, etc.

This will take a shapefile and copy it to a file called merge. Wrappers for the geospatial data abstraction library gdal. Ogr supports many data formats here is a subset of the ones we commonly use. The geospatial data abstraction library gdal is an open source library and set of tools for converting and manipulating spatial data. Esri shapefile, mapinfo tab file, csv, dbf, gml, kml, interlis, sqlite, geopackage,spatialite, odbc, esri geodatabase mdb format, esri gdb database, postgis. More generally, consult the documentation page of the input and output drivers for performance. Convert kml to csv wkt first list layers in the kml file.

The first field of the source layer is used to fill. Feb 21, 2011 ogr2ogr cant insert spatial data directly into sql server 2008, but it can create csv files that can be read into sql server. When the hyperv host is running, we are able to attach the csv volumes from the driver without any issues. These tables can be safely ignored or deleted ogr2ogr will recreate them after each conversion anyway. Gdal gives the possibility to create gdal virtual formats. Sign up for free to join this conversation on github. Ogr2ogr patterns for sql server alastair aitchison. You can also manually set layer creation options to dictate the field delimiter and line return character of the csv file, using the lineformat. For example, if the environment variable pkgroot points to the folder that holds the unzipped mapserver distribution and environment variable libdir points. If you installed gdal from a package, the location of this program is likely usrbingdalconfig, but it may be in another place depending on how your packager arranged things. Exporting spatial data from sql server to esri shapefile. These last few parameters use lco flags to signalize various creation options used by the csv driver. That csv file is wrapped by an xml file that describes it as an ogr. Terminating translation prematurely after failed translation of layer mylayer use skipfailures to skip errors.

The gdalogr library itself has a ogr osm driver that supports reading osm xml and pbf files starting with gdal 1. Layer mylayer already exists, and append not specified. After that, check the header checkbox because our csv file has a header, choose comma, as the delimiter, and click the import button. Convert, reproject, and load spatial data to sql server. Ideal for writing data import programs and conversion programs. It can then create a map from source field names to target field names.

The example problem is needing to merge 9 shapefiles. This name should match one of the formats listed as supported for the f argument to ogr2ogr in the ogr2ogr usage message. Writing features to mssql server mssqlspatial fails. Esri shapefile, mapinfo tab file, csv, dbf, gml, kml, interlis, sqlite, geopackage,spatialite, odbc, esri geodatabase mdb format, esri gdb database, postgispostgresql, mysql. Converting csv files to esri shapefile format geocode. Gdal ogr2ogr for data loading postgres online journal. Read a csv of coordinates as an ogrvrtlayer gdalogr has a virtual format spec that allows you to derive layers from flat tables such as a csv it does a lot more than that too so go read about it. Terminating translation prematurely after failed translation of layer ogrgeojson use skipfailures to skip errors. Terminating translation prematurely after failed translation of layer ogrgeojson use.

Rsiggeo convert kml file into shape file or csv file. Import csv file into posgresql table postgresql tutorial. I am experiencing the same on windows 2008r2 using ogr2ogr from osgeo 64bit gdal version 2. The goal is for ogr2ogr to support most if not all formats your underlying ogr2ogr supports. The conversion of csv files to projected vector files here well use esri shapefile format can be automated using gdals ogr2ogr library. To create a file to merge into use the following command. Below is a simple example to export a table to dbase. I am running the following ogr2ogr command line to import a shp file into my sql server db. Finally, when the import process completes, click the done button. Attempt to create csv layer file against a nondirectory datasource. Im using the file provided in the guide and the user in the connection string is the admin so it is not a permission problem. To create an output file in csv format, set the f csv output option. Providing the exact message from the log\errorlog file would be quite helpful since there are both multiple appdomains and multiple reasons for appdomains to get unloaded regarding the various appdomains, there are appdomains created for builtin clrbased functionality, such as one that shows up in master when certain functions e. That csv file is wrapped by an xml file that describes it as an ogr layer.

You can use preconfigured database driver or create new driver. Alternatively, if you want to export to a different file format, visit theogr formats page, select the appropriate driver, and readup on the various creation options. If you want to know more about the csv creation options, check out the ogr csv driver page. Importing osm geofabrik data into oracle database with gdalogr. I rely on ogr2ogr, an utility from the library ogrgdal and the virtual table format a way to wrap other format in order to make some custom things be careful, were using version 1. The command does not create the table and the inserts fails. Export shapefile from sql server using ogr2ogr github. Failed to create coordinate transformation between the. The ogr renderer will support the following formatoption declarations. Contribute to wavded ogr2ogr development by creating an account on github. The ability to visualise csv files within a gis usually requires a couple of steps if you are operating your gis in a point and click fashion. Convert, reproject, and load spatial data to sql server with. Creating another csv file into directory with invalid csv.

All command shell commands should be executed in that folder. A solution would be that ogr2ogr, just after calling createfield. Nov 27, 2015 convert kml to csv wkt first list layers in the kml file. Open the windows command line, by going to the start menu run type in cmd and press enter. In g, you can modify pointers to include files and libraries. Ogr2ogr cant insert spatial data directly into sql server 2008, but it can create csv files that can be read into sql server. Shapefile driver truncated field names, sometimes causing. The imagemode for ogr output is feature, but this is implicit and does not need to be explicitly stated for ogr output driver declarations.

It would be great to allow buffered callscurrently entire spatial files are read into memory to see their data. Ogr2ogr merge shapefiles north river geographic systems inc. If you get the following result, then congratulations your gdal installation worked smoothly. Vrt descriptions of datasets can be saved in an xml format normally given the extension. In the example below we are reading in a csv with x,y columns and values. Mar 12, 2020 see examples for usage examples and testapi. The drivers specifications indicate that this driver is capable of efficiently reading the contents of databases with large numbers of fields, without depending in any way upon proprietary software. Apr 03, 2012 it will check that ogr2ogr is installed and allow some queries to be made. We suspect that filter driver failed to attach csv volume, since cluster service was not started at that point of time during the system start up. The creation options are unique for each dataset ogr can export, and in this case im demonstrating a particular recipie. Importing osm geofabrik data into oracle database with gdalogr written by andrew fomin on march, 07 2016 this post is the third in line of posts about maps generally and open street maps in particular.

In this tutorial, we have shown you how to import data from csv. For ogr output it is highly desirable to be able to create the output fields with the appropriate datatype, width and precision. Gdalogr has a virtual format spec that allows you to derive layers from flat tables such as a csv it does a lot more than that too so go read about it. It has several parts, some networklink structures without urls that just provide some html info boxes, and some network link structures that point to other kmz files. App domain unloaded when using gdalogr ogr2ogr to insert. Ogr2ogr fails to load into sql server memory allocation. This is fine for a couple of files, but where you have multiple csv files, this takes wastes a lot of time. I dont know the answers to these questions, but since there are obviously some people out there looking for this kind of information and since i know, from experience, that ogr2ogr can be an absolute bugger to get working correctly heres another post about ogr2ogr anyway and this time its about exporting spatial data from sql server. Outputformat name csv driver ogr csv mimetype text csv formatoption lco.

1578 1480 117 363 34 156 1480 953 597 265 1563 1121 663 326 330 1511 313 412 1141 146 272 482 1299 929 206 344 638 1005 1184 1235 951 891 998 693 625 732 1277 480 63 398 892 1270 864